Are you ready to unveil the wonders of the Umbria region? This day excursion from Florence invites you to discover two remarkable cities: Perugia, celebrated for its chocolate and medieval artistry, and Assisi, revered as the spiritual center of Saint Francis.

Day Trip Overview

We will convene at the designated hour at Piazzale Montelungo, located in the center of Florence. Once all participants are assembled, we will depart from Tuscany and venture into the picturesque Umbrian hills.

Our journey commences in Perugia, a charming hilltop city brimming with personality. You will have leisure time to independently explore its notable sites, including Piazza IV Novembre, where the stunning Fontana Maggiore and the Cathedral stand. Be sure to visit the Rocca Paolina, a remarkable underground fortress that uncovers intriguing aspects of the city's past.

For those who enjoy sweets, Perugia holds the title of the European chocolate capital. Consider indulging in an optional chocolate tasting at a Eurochocolate store to delve deeper into its delectable offerings.

After exploring Perugia, we will proceed to Assisi. Interestingly, the hill where this town currently resides was formerly dubbed “Hill of Hell.” The construction of the Basilica of Saint Francis dramatically transformed it into the “Hill of Paradise.”

As we wander through the narrow medieval alleyways, your guide will unveil the town’s rich heritage and tales. A visit to the Basilica of Saint Francis awaits, where you can admire exquisite frescoes by renowned artists such as Giotto, Cimabue, and Simone Martini. Following the guided portion, you will enjoy additional free time to further explore. You may wish to visit the Basilica of Saint Clare, see the tomb of Carlo Acutis, recognized as the first millennial saint, or simply unwind with a coffee in the central square.

Before our return to Florence, we will make a concluding stop at the Papal Basilica of Saint Mary of the Angels. This magnificent church contains the Porziuncola, the small chapel that marked the commencement of the Franciscan order.

Ultimately, we will arrive back at the initial meeting point in Florence, thereby concluding this enriching 11-hour journey.
